Decoding Social Media Algorithms for Better Follower Interaction
Understanding social media algorithms is crucial for anyone looking to enhance their follower interaction. Algorithms largely influence how content appears in a user’s feed. These algorithms analyze various factors to determine what users see based on their preferences, behaviors, and previous interactions. To effectively engage with followers, it’s imperative to grasp how these algorithms work. These systems provide a ranking of posts, prioritizing those deemed most relevant to individual users. Factors such as user engagement, post authenticity, and timeliness play significant roles in this ranking process. More engagement often leads to higher visibility in feeds. By consistently creating content that resonates with your audience, you will encourage interactions that signal the algorithm to promote your posts. The critical components behind algorithms focus not just on follower count, but real engagement metrics. User activity levels and shared content types also significantly impact visibility. Awareness of these features can aid in strategizing content that not only attracts followers but also retains their attention and fosters community around your brand.
As you delve deeper into social media algorithms, it’s essential to explore how engagement affects organic reach. The essence of engagement lies in likes, comments, shares, and saves. These metrics provide critical feedback the algorithms rely on for content ranking. When users engage with posts actively, algorithms recognize and reward such behaviors by showcasing that content to a wider audience. Therefore, crafting posts that compel followers to act—whether by liking or sharing—can significantly improve visibility. High-quality visuals and compelling captions can draw more engagement, enabling your content to travel further and reach new users. It’s also important to encourage two-way communication. Building relationships through comments and messages allows followers to feel valued, enhancing loyalty. Regularly interacting with your audience ensures that they remain engaged, increasing the likelihood of seeing your future posts. Keep in mind that consistency in content is vital, too. Posting regularly keeps your audience engaged and signals to algorithms that your content is relevant and worth promoting. Therefore, understanding and leveraging engagement-centric strategies is key to navigating social media algorithms effectively.
The Role of Content Quality
In today’s social media landscape, the quality of content is paramount. Algorithms favor high-quality, authentic content over generic or poorly produced materials. Users are drawn to visually appealing posts that tell a story and evoke emotions. Content that resonates with followers is likely to get shared, further amplifying its reach. It’s essential to maintain authenticity by sharing genuine experiences and insights. This drives more meaningful interactions, which are also favored by algorithms. Additionally, incorporating trending topics and relevant hashtags can make your content more discoverable. However, it’s vital to ensure that the hashtags are relevant to your post; otherwise, they can mislead your audience. Regularly analyzing insights helps in understanding what resonates with your audience, allowing for more informed content creation. By focusing on creating diverse content types—such as videos, infographics, and stories—you can cater to varying audience preferences. This multifaceted approach will fulfill different user needs, ensuring your content remains relevant and engaging across the board. Ultimately, quality content is the backbone of effective social media strategies and user engagement.

Utilizing Analytics for Improvement
Analytics play a critical role in understanding user engagement across social media platforms. By regularly reviewing performance metrics, you can identify which types of content resonate most with your audience. This information is invaluable when it comes to tweaking your strategies for better results. Tracking metrics such as likes, shares, comments, and reach are vital in forming a comprehensive picture of how your content performs. A/B testing different posts can help you hone in on which visuals, formats, and messaging strategies yield the highest engagement. Through detailed analysis, you can understand your audience’s preferences, enabling you to produce more targeted content moving forward. It’s also imperative to analyze demographic data, allowing you to tailor content to various segments of your audience. Data-driven decisions help eliminate guesswork and promote focused creativity. Social media platforms offer built-in analytics tools that make tracking these metrics straightforward and manageable. The continuous cycle of evaluation and adjustment based on analytics ensures sustained follower interaction and growth. Therefore, investing time in understanding analytics can create a more dynamic and effective social media presence.
